One name in the coaching carousel that hasn’t quite come up to the extent that perhaps I had thought it would is Baylor coach Art Briles. Although Briles is just a game shy of holding a .500 record during his four seasons in Waco, the success he’s been able to achieve there in the past two years is remarkable.
It helps to have Robert Griffin III.
But Baylor is making sure that Briles is well taken care of in an effort to try to keep him around. The Houston Chronicle reports that Briles is on the receiving end of a contract extension, although the length of it remains unknown.
Briles already had five years left on his contract, but this should sweeten his deal a little more.
It’s a good move.
One thing that’s been really impressive about Baylor is the team development around RGIII as this season progressed. I honestly believe this Baylor squad is better as a whole now than it was when they upset TCU at the beginning of the season.
That’s good coaching. Good coaching that has earned an extension.
